Bolesworth Castle, nestled near Tattenhall in Cheshire, England, is a historic Grade II listed country house set within a sprawling estate of over 6,000 acres. Renowned for its stunning countryside backdrop and versatile event spaces, it hosts weddings, corporate events, and festivals such as the Together Again Festival. The estate features the Lakeside Pavilion and Castle View Pavilion, offering elegant venues with panoramic views, surrounded by mature woodlands and picturesque lakes.

Car
Accessible via the A41 road, Bolesworth Castle is approximately 8 miles south of Chester. Ample on-site parking is available. Travel time from Chester is around 20-30 minutes. Note that during major events, traffic congestion may occur, so plan accordingly.
Train and Taxi
The nearest train station is Chester, about 8 miles away. From there, taxis are available with a journey time of approximately 20 minutes. Taxi fares typically range from £20 to £30.
Coach Services
For large events and festivals, dedicated coach services operate from major nearby cities such as Manchester and Liverpool. These services run on event days only and require advance booking, with prices varying by route.
Walking
While the estate grounds are extensive and scenic, walking to Bolesworth Castle from nearby villages like Tattenhall is possible but involves rural roads and uneven terrain, taking about 45-60 minutes. Not recommended for those with mobility issues.
